What’s the Deal with Fuzzy Logic?

Fuzzy logic came into play to tackle issues where our traditional binary logic falls short. Think about it: how often do we deal with vague terms? For example, when someone says it’s “warm” outside, what does that mean? Is it 75 degrees or 85 degrees? Fuzzy logic allows that statement to hold a truth value anywhere from 0 to 1, rather than just being a simple true or false. Real-World Applications: Why It Matters

Fuzzy logic isn’t just theory; it has practical applications all around us! For starters, think about control systems. Ever used an air conditioner or a washing machine? These devices often rely on fuzzy logic to determine when to kick in or shut off. Instead of just heating or cooling to a set temperature, they can adapt to the user’s needs, improving efficiency and comfort. Pretty neat!

And guess what? It doesn’t stop there. Fuzzy logic is also a cornerstone in artificial intelligence. It enables machines to think and react in a way that mimics human reasoning. For example, when computers analyze data and recognize patterns, they often use fuzzy logic to make sense of vague information. Who knew math could be so helpful in our daily lives?
